Eligibility

Inclusion criteria

Inclusion criteria: CHILDREN AGED 3 TO 10 YEARS WITH COOPERATIVE. BEHAVIOUR SUITABLE FOR CLINICAL PROCEDURES. PRESENCE OF PRIMARY MOLARS WITH OCCLUSAL CARIES REQUIRING RESTORATION. TEETH WITH CARIOUS LESIONS EXTENDING TO THE DENTINE ICDAS CODES 2. TEETH WITH SUFFICIENT STRUCTURE TO ALLOW PROPER ISOLATION AND RESTORATION PLACEMENT. PATIENTS WHOSE PARENTS OR GUARDIANS PROVIDED WRITTEN INFORMED CONSENT.

Exclusion criteria

Exclusion criteria: PATIENTS HAVING ANY CHRONIC MEDICAL DISEASES. HYPOCALCIFICATION OR DEVELOPMENTAL ANOMALY. CHILDREN WITH SYSTEMIC DISEASES OR CONDITIONS CONTRAINDICATING DENTAL TREATMENT. PRIMARY MOLARS WITH PULPAL INVOLVEMENT ABSCESS OR FISTULA. PREVIOUSLY RESTORED OR FRACTURED PRIMARY MOLARS. PATIENTS WITH POOR ORAL HYGIENE OR UNCOOPERATIVE BEHAVIOUR MAKING ISOLATION OR RESTORATION DIFFICULT. CHILDREN WITH KNOWN ALLERGY OR SENSITIVITY TO GLASS IONOMER CEMENT OR NANOPARTICLES.

Design outcomes

Primary

MeasureTime frame
THE STUDY IS EXPECTED TO SHOW THAT CERIUM OXIDE NANOPARTICLES MODIFIED GIC MAY PERFORM BETTER THAN CONVENTIONAL GIC IN TERMS OF STRENGTH DURABILITY AND PREVENTION OF FURTHER TOOTH DECAY IN CHILDREN.Timepoint: 9 MONTHS

Secondary

MeasureTime frame
SECONDARY OUTCOMES WILL INCLUDE ASSESSMENT OF COLOR MATCH SURFACE SMOOTHNESS MARGINAL DISCOLORATION POSTOPERATIVE SENSITIVITY AND PATIENT COMFORT BETWEEN THE TWO FILLING MATERIALS OVER THE FOLLOW-UP PERIOD.Timepoint: 9 MONTHS
